White collar crime is a term signifying assorted types of non-violent crime committed by individuals, as well as corporations, their employees and officers. The category encompasses securities fraud, bribery, extortion, embezzlement, theft and other violations of trust committed in the course of employment, including bribery, racketeering, price-fixing, government contract fraud, perjury and false declarations, stock manipulation, insider trading, RICO and mail fraud. The foregoing definition is not meant to be all inclusive.
